Rust on CodeQL

Warning

Rust support for CodeQL is experimental. No support is offered. QL and database interfaces will change and break without notice or deprecation periods.

Building the Rust Extractor

This approach uses a released codeql version and is simpler to use for QL development. From your semmle-code directory run:

bazel run @codeql//rust:rust-installer

You now need to create a per-user CodeQL configuration file and specify the option:

--search-path PATH/TO/semmle-code/ql

(wherever the codeql checkout is on your system)

You can now use the Rust extractor e.g. to run Rust tests from the command line or in VSCode.

Building the Rust Extractor (as a sembuild target)

This approach allows you to build a Rust extractor with a CLI built from source. From your semmle-code directory run:

./build target/intree/codeql-rust

You can now invoke it directly, for example to run some tests:

./target/intree/codeql-rust/codeql test run ql/rust/ql/test/PATH/TO/TEST/
